to_address_masked
Convert a Uint or U256 value to a valid address (20 bytes).
Parameters
data : The numeric value to be converted to address.
Returns
address : Address
The obtained address.
def to_address_masked(data: Uint | U256) -> Address:

compute_contract_address
Computes address of the new account that needs to be created.
Parameters
address : The address of the account that wants to create the new account. nonce : The transaction count of the account that wants to create the new account.
Returns
address: Address
The computed address of the new account.
def compute_contract_address(address: Address, nonce: Uint) -> Address:

compute_create2_contract_address
Computes address of the new account that needs to be created, which is based on the sender address, salt and the call data as well.
Parameters
address : The address of the account that wants to create the new account. salt : Address generation salt. call_data : The code of the new account which is to be created.
Returns
address:
